클라우드 서버 데이터베이스 설치 방법, 클라우드 서버 데이터베이스에 소프트웨어 설치 방법
클라우드 서버 데이터베이스를 설치하는 방법? 자세한 가이드 및 FAQ
오늘날 정보화 시대에 클라우드 서버는 애플리케이션을 구축하는 많은 기업과 개발자에게 선호되는 선택이 되었습니다. 클라우드 서버는 강력한 처리 능력뿐만 아니라 유연한 리소스 할당과 높은 확장성을 제공합니다. 클라우드 서버에 데이터베이스를 설치하는 것은 매우 일반적인 요구 사항입니다. 이 글에서는 클라우드 서버에 데이터베이스를 설치하는 방법을 자세히 설명하고 몇 가지 일반적인 질문에 답합니다.
1. 제품 매개변수
데이터베이스를 설치하기 전에 서버 및 데이터베이스 구성을 이해하는 것이 중요합니다. 다음은 가장 적합한 구성을 선택하는 데 도움이 되는 클라우드 서버 제품 매개변수입니다.
제품 유형 | CPU 코어 수 | 메모리 | 저장 공간 | 네트워크 대역폭 | 운영 체제 |
---|---|---|---|---|---|
표준 클라우드 서버 | 2개의 코어 | 4GB | 50GB | 1Gbps | 리눅스/윈도우 |
고성능 클라우드 서버 | 4개의 코어 | 8GB | 100GB | 2Gbps | 리눅스/윈도우 |
엔터프라이즈급 클라우드 서버 | 8개의 코어 | 16GB | 200GB | 5Gbps | 리눅스/윈도우 |
2. 클라우드 서버 데이터베이스 설치 단계
데이터베이스를 설치하기 전에 먼저 선택한 클라우드 서버가 준비되었는지 확인해야 합니다. 그런 다음 다음 단계에 따라 설치하세요.
1단계: 적합한 데이터베이스를 선택하세요. 일반적인 데이터베이스로는 MySQL, PostgreSQL, MongoDB가 있습니다. 데이터베이스를 선택할 때는 비즈니스 요구 사항과 성능 요구 사항을 고려하세요.
2단계: SSH를 사용하여 클라우드 서버에 로그인하세요. 서버의 IP 주소, 사용자 이름, 비밀번호를 입력하여 설치를 수행할 수 있는 권한이 있는지 확인하세요.
3단계: 필요한 소프트웨어 패키지를 설치합니다. 선택한 데이터베이스에 따라 해당 설치 명령을 실행합니다. 예:
- MySQL 데이터베이스의 경우 다음 명령을 사용하세요.
sudo apt-get update sudo apt-get install mysql-server
- PostgreSQL 데이터베이스의 경우 다음 명령을 사용하세요.
sudo apt-get update sudo apt-get install postgresql postgresql-contrib
4단계: 데이터베이스 구성 설치가 완료되면 데이터베이스의 몇 가지 기본 매개변수를 구성해야 합니다. 구성 파일을 편집하여 데이터베이스 수신 주소, 포트, 사용자 권한 등을 설정할 수 있습니다.
5단계: 다음 명령을 사용하여 데이터베이스 서비스를 시작하고 자동으로 시작되는지 확인하세요.
- MySQL:
sudo systemctl start mysql sudo systemctl enable mysql
- 포스트그레스큐엘:
sudo systemctl start postgresql sudo systemctl enable postgresql
6단계: 설치 확인 데이터베이스에 로그인하여 설치가 성공적으로 완료되었는지 확인하세요. MySQL의 경우 다음 명령을 사용할 수 있습니다.
mysql -u root -p
PostgreSQL의 경우 다음 명령을 사용할 수 있습니다.
psql -U postgres
3. 클라우드 서버 데이터베이스 설치에 대한 FAQ
질문: 클라우드 서버 데이터베이스를 설치할 때 데이터베이스 유형을 어떻게 선택해야 하나요? 답변: 데이터베이스 유형을 선택할 때는 먼저 애플리케이션의 요구 사항을 고려하세요. 예를 들어 MySQL은 트랜잭션 작업에 적합하고, PostgreSQL은 높은 동시성 읽기 및 쓰기에 적합하며, MongoDB는 비관계형 데이터 처리에 적합합니다. 프로젝트 요구 사항, 데이터 양, 성능 요구 사항을 고려하여 선택하세요.
질문: 설치 중 "종속성 패키지 누락" 문제가 발생하면 어떻게 해야 하나요? 답변: 데이터베이스 설치 중 "종속성 패키지 누락" 문제가 발생하면 운영 체제 소프트웨어 패키지를 업데이트하여 해결할 수 있습니다. 다음 명령을 사용하여 모든 패키지를 업데이트하세요.
sudo apt-get update sudo apt-get upgrade
업데이트가 완료된 후 데이터베이스를 다시 설치해 보세요.
질문: 데이터베이스 보안을 어떻게 보장하시나요? 답변: 데이터베이스 보안을 위한 조치에는 강력한 암호 설정, 외부 접근 제한(신뢰할 수 있는 IP 주소에서만 접근 허용), 방화벽 구성, 그리고 취약점 해결을 위한 데이터베이스 소프트웨어 정기 업데이트 등이 있습니다. SSL/TLS 암호화를 활성화하여 데이터 전송 보안을 강화할 수도 있습니다.
4. 요약
클라우드 서버에 데이터베이스를 설치하는 것은 복잡하지 않지만, 필요에 따라 세부적인 설정이 필요합니다. 적절한 클라우드 서버 구성과 데이터베이스 유형을 선택하고 설치 단계를 따르면 데이터베이스 환경을 성공적으로 구축할 수 있습니다. 정기적인 유지 관리 및 보안 점검을 통해 데이터베이스의 안정성과 보안을 보장합니다. 이 가이드가 클라우드 서버 데이터베이스 설치를 성공적으로 완료하는 데 도움이 되기를 바랍니다.